Odisha Bus Accident: 5 Dead, Many Injured as Kolkata-Bound Bus Falls from Bridge in Jajpur

Five people, including a woman, died, and around 40 others were injured after a Kolkata-bound bus plunged from a bridge in Odisha's Jajpur district on Monday evening.

According to PTI reports, the incident occurred around 9 pm on Barabati Bridge on National Highway-16 as the bus, carrying 50 passengers, travelled from Puri to Kolkata. Four men and one woman lost their lives. Tapan Kumar Naik, Inspector in charge of Dharamshala Police Station told PTI that around 30 of the injured were taken to Cuttack SCB Medical College.

A rescue operation is ongoing at the scene.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ik expressed condolences and announced an ex-gratia of Rs 3 lakh each for the deceased's next of kin.
